| Feature | Avee Coco Coir | Peat Moss | Rockwool |
|---|---|---|---|
| Renewable source | Yes — coconut byproduct | No — non-renewable | No — synthetic basalt |
| pH stability | Stable 5.5–6.5 | Acidic, needs lime | Neutral |
| Moisture retention | Excellent, stays hydrated | Good | Poor, dries fast |
| EC/pH batch certificate | Every single batch | Not standard | Available |
| Multi-season reuse | Up to 3 full seasons | Single use only | Disposal issues |
